Amendment 0001 is hereby issued to Revise Evaluation 1 Factor: Technical Capability, CLIN 4 Description with Quantity, CLIN 17 Quantity (Attachment B), and to extend the due date to Friday, August 21, 2026 by 04:00 pm MDT. _________________________________________________________________________ **THIS IS AN INDIAN-OWNED SMALL BUSINESS ECONOMIC ENTERPRISE (ISBEE) SET-ASIDE** The Indian Health Service, Kayenta Health Center located at Highway 160 Mile Post 394.3, Kayenta AZ 86033 has a requirement for providing Chemical, Biological, Radiological, and Nuclear (CBRN) respiratory protection equipment and hazardous material (hazmat) response supplies. The Government will award a contract on a Best Value Trade-Off basis to the responsible offeror whose quotation represents the best overall value to the Government, price and non-price factors considered. The Government will evaluate quotations based on three primary factors, listed in descending order of importance: Technical Capability and Demonstrated Experience (Most Significant) Price Delivery Schedule (Least Significant) As the technical differences between proposals decrease, the importance of price in the final award decision will increase. The Government reserves the right to award to other than the lowest-priced offeror if the superior technical capability or qualifications of a higher-priced offeror warrants the additional cost. Offerors must strictly follow the submission instructions detailed in Section E (page 20) of this solicitation to be considered for evaluation and award. All technical and administrative questions must be submitted via email no later than Wednesday, August 5th at 5:00pm EDT. Questions received after this deadline may not be answered. Please ensure all quotations are prepared in strict accordance with these instructions. Failure to provide any of the required documentation shall render the quotation incomplete and ineligible for award without further evaluation. The Government shall keep the solicitation posted and open for quotes until August 10, 2026, 2:00pm EDT. _________________________________________________________________________ All responses to this solicitation are due no later than Friday, August 21, 2026, 04:00 pm MDT to email address: Brandon.Martinez@ihs.gov
